Aims and Scope
The Harvard Journal of Law and Public Policy is a law review for conservative and libertarian legal scholarship. It was established by Harvard Law School students Spencer Abraham and Stephen Eberhard in 1978, leading to the founding of the Federalist Society, for which it is the official journal. It is one of the top five most widely circulated law reviews in the United States. Less
